Salem Has Been Renewed For A Third Season


Salem is an American supernatural fiction drama television series. It has been renewed for a third season. The show, which is the cable network's first original scripted drama, recently concluded Season 2, where it averaged over 1.1 million total viewers. Production on Season 3 will begin later this year, with an expected premiere in 2016.
